If someone would be considering practicing real estate in Naples, Fl. some thinking would be required. If you want to work in Southwest Florida the product is a much sought after vacation haven that was over speculated more than 99% of the nations markets. That makes it a brisk or fast-moving buyers market. The buyer is in charge and having his way with the sellers. You will most likely be representing sellers. That is a tough job.
A. You will find it hard to be a hero, if you are successful your client probably lost a lot of money.At best he broke even and but still remembers when he could have doubled his money but held on for more.
B. The buyers are not going to appreciate you making money from their investment and they will not show a lot of loyalty unless you know more than they do. You will have to understand a great deal of short sale, foreclosure, and market segment characteristics and the current trends of all above.
C. Banks, mortgages and down payment requirements. Times are changing but the easiest sell for your property is a cash buyer. If your property is a vacation treasure property then this is likely, but if it is not then very pre-approved buyers must be the only offers to spend your sellers good will and trust on. If you waste their time you are heading for heartbreak.
D. Be prepared for a slow summer, do not elevate your overhead cost such as listing maintenance cost until October, you have to prospect for next seasons listings, If you are going to represent buyers find a realtor with 100 listings and get them to refer buyers to you. Off season is a great time to get specialized certifications to add to your value on the team, being bi-lingual is a great certification to start with. Senior citizen specialist is good and Short sale, foreclosure, research is required. Some college courses like finance and Business administration gives polish to all transactions you control.
E. Some understudy work for a builder a year or two would create the knowledge of home construction and sales basics. I worked for Radio Shack off and on for ten years and developed a keen instinct of peoples needs from someone selling them something they need. Listening, Listening and listening. Finding what they need, hearing what they want and giving value if you ask them to spend more than they were prepared for.
If you want to give a service then you can do that in practicing real estate in Naples, if you want to get rich fast, invent something. Being successful in real estate requires 7 16 hour days a week and a very thick skin. That is a quick list of pros and cons to real estate work in Southwest Florida.
